Descripción

The central type sits in the middle of the somatograph: endomorphy, mesomorphy, and ectomorphy all between 2 and 4, and no component more than one unit greater than the other two. Visually, this is the 'average build' across most adult populations.

Central body shapes appear in students, office workers, and many recreational athletes: bodies that have neither been pushed toward an extreme by sport selection nor toward unusual fatness or linearity by sedentary lifestyle.

The original Heath-Carter literature treats Central as the statistical reference type rather than a target. It is the body shape before specialisation. Trained athletes typically migrate away from Central toward one of the three corners as their sport selects for one component.

From a coaching standpoint, a Central somatotype has the widest range of options: most disciplines will move the body at least slightly toward one corner, and the starting point is balanced enough that there is no strong contraindication for any kind of training.
